I know this have been discussed before, but my decision depends on a very specific factor. Some of you have advised getting the Er4P and the Xin SuperDual amp with p->s switch. This sounds like a great idea for me since I only want to use the amp when I study at a library or when I'm at home. For exercise and walking around campus, I think it would be a hassle to carry sth extra around. My main concern about the Er4P is its loudness from my Sony D-777 discman due to its impedance...I like to listen to classical at times, and want pretty low volume when I work. So my question is whether or not using the Er4P on the Sony D-777 be very loud....some ppl had issues about using it with the iPod.
Also, would using the Er4S without an amp at a gym with the D-777 be a problem?

I just bought a Er4P, it arrived last week (sounds great, btw). I chose the 4P because I have the option of converting the 4P to a 4S when adding the Er4P-24 cable, available from Ety. Here's a link: http://www.etymotic.com/ephp/er4-acc.asp

From what I've read in other threads, the 4P with the above cable sounds exactly like a 4S. I haven't bought the cable yet.
